Posted on 9/16/17 at 3:45 pm to TigrrrDad
quote:
At least he didn't make those stupid faces most interpreters make.
The "stupid" facial expressions are extremely important in everyday sign language. It is facial expressions & body language used to deliver a message.
NYC storm interpreters Lydia Callis( Bloomberg) & Jonathan Lamberton ( De Blasio) were appreciated greatly in the deaf community.
Jonathan Lamberton was born deaf & understands this importance.
